Another cold day here. We went to St. J. this morning and it was a tad colder there than it was here, by about a degree or so. We had 10 above, but it didn't get very warm all day. Now, at 5:15 p.m., I see 6.7F on my weather station. It's cold and calm.
    People were still going about their business in spite of the cold. There weren't a lot of people at the mall when I was there this morning, but it was only 9 a.m., so I expect lots of folks waited for the weather to warm up a little. The sun was out and that was very nice for a change.
     Today was the shortest day of the year, but it didn't seem so because the sun was so bright. Most days have been cloudy, so darkness has come earlier. The good news is that from now on our days will be getting a little longer!

Final 2017 Construction Update
Cabot Danville US 2 Reconstruction
FEGC F 028-3(26) C/2
                                                                    
Project Location:  The 1.4 mile project extends along US 2 from Last Road to Danville Hill Road in Cabot. This is a multi-year project with most of the work occurring in 2017/2018. Completion is scheduled for 2019.
  Final 2017 Construction Update
December 21, 2017
  Crews will be wrapping up work on the project for the winter and covering the construction signs as early as tomorrow or shortly after Christmas.  Work will resume next March or April, depending on the weather conditions, and continue throughout the year.

Prior to work commencing in the spring, information will be provided with an overall scope of work and schedule for the 2018 construction season.  Weekly construction updates will also be issued throughout the construction season.

This is the final 2017 construction update for the project.
